In our experience, ghost pepper plants will not produce too many peppers when temperatures are very high (above 90°F). In fact, our plants usually produce best later in the season, after the hottest part of the summer is over.

Web23 feb. 2024 · In 2007, the ghost pepper (Bhut Jolokia) was named the world’s hottest pepper by Guinness World Records when it scored 1,041,427 SHU. Today, there are many different types of ghost peppers … WebRed peppers are the most well-known and extremely spicy. Yellow is still hot but less intense. Orange is usually smaller and still packs a punch. White has a smoother texture and notes of citrus. Brown is more pungent and sweet. Peach has the same heat as reds and a fruity aftertaste.
